Vista and Live - Glitches
Since I bought a new notebook with Windows Vista preinstalled I now have to deal with this operation system.
When using Ableton Live I always have glitches which means some tracks are left out for some time until the HD-Led in Live is off again.
I bought a 7200 rpm Hitachi Travelstar so datathroughput should not be the problem.
When I watched the ressources overview in Vista it seems that the memory (2 gb) gets full (hard fault) and a pagefile is written on the harddisk which thwarts the whole systems so the 22 stereo tracks in Live cannot be played back correctly.
With Windows XP there has never been a problem - I even played a whole video with Arkaos VJ simultaneosly. Does Vista take so much more memory than XP? (I optimized Vista for audio which means i switched off the backup-function, optimized for background processes, index off, graphic fx off, etc.)
Maybe my graphic card maybe responsible for the swap-file? It is a Geforce 8400 M which has 128 MB memory but also uses the RAM. Does anybody know where to controll the amount of ram it uses? I found nothing in the bios nor in Vista-configuration.
Can anybody help me?

Re: Vista and Live - Glitches
I don't think this is a swap-file problem. The reason why RAM gets filled up is Superfetch. Vista always keeps the file-cache filled. You can try yourself by switching off Superfetch via "Services".wojna wrote:When I watched the ressources overview in Vista it seems that the memory (2 gb) gets full (hard fault) and a pagefile is written on the harddisk which thwarts the whole systems so the 22 stereo tracks in Live cannot be played back correctly.
Concerning Live and Vista: I am very adept at configuring about anything PC, but I did not manage to get this combination running smoothly on three different PCs. The only thing you can try is to activate AERO since this helps alot to make Live running better on Vista (albeit not as good as on XP). Additionally you can also try to switch off Multiprocessor support, but that's a ridiculous "workaround".
Ableton keeps failing to deliver the advertised Vista compatibility I fear. At least I'm waiting for solutions since months.

Done. I switched back to XP. It took me the whole of monday. But now it is done.
I needed to create an new Windows-XP-Install-CD because on the original disc there was no SATA-Support for my harddisc. But this was no problem. Found a good tutorial and build a new disc with DriverPacks and nLite, so installing became possible.
Funny that ASUS had no drivers at all für my Z53S Notebook on their homepage, but I found out that the XP drivers for Z53Sc also work.
Everything works fine now. Bootup is really quick.
Now CPU-Load in Ableton in the SAME arrangement dropped from 15% to 7% percent. No dropouts at all while Arkaos is simultaniously playing a big videofile. It is wonderful.
